A rough rule I use myself: if a mistake just costs you time or a part, DIY is usually fine to attempt with some research. If a mistake could mean structural damage, a safety system (brakes, propane, high-voltage electrical), or something that gets much more expensive if done wrong, that's when calling a tech first — even just for a phone consult — is worth it before diving in.
